Which chart to use

In most of my talks I present quantitative evidence of patterns, data exploration or results. But which is the right way to show that evidence? Worry no more: the Extreme Presentation Method helps you to decide with this chart chooser (click here to download the pdf)

My impression is that this chart chooser is good for small data. For big data some of the charts render useless. For example, read the insightfull post Don’t use Scatterplots by Chris Stucchio on why is not a good idea to use scatterplots to show relationship between bivariate data when you have large amounts of data.
